炫酷java雷霆战机代码 炫酷java雷霆战机代码是什么

手机为什么好卡她自我介绍一下,我是百度知道用户懒洋洋的女儿,今年9岁了,
上二年级期末考试考了双满分,我很开心 , 现在我站在一个9岁孩子的角度来给你回答一下这个问题,手机为什么好卡?可能是因为你的手机里的软件太多,删一些就会好了,还有就是软件可能有些人的软件很少,但是手机也卡,人家少的话要看你软件你的空间如果软件占的空间大的话,那也是要删除一定的软件的,还有就是你手机的硬件老化了,基本上手手机或者其他的一些数码产品两年就要更换,如果手机这个是那你坏了自己就不要去修,要去一些专门的店里去修,要么自己在家骨头骨头有骨头坏了,原来还是挺好的,一个手机现在给骨头坏了,那是不是白买了,这就是手机硬件老化 , 硬件老化就导致这个手机特别卡,你的手机就应该更换 。
为什么安卓手机越用越卡 , 而苹果手机就不会?现在随着手机的硬件配置越来越高,2016年已经出现了譬如一加手机3,还有VIVO , 小米等多家旗舰的4G内存空间的手机,甚至还出现了6G内存空间的手机,但是流畅度方面,仍然赶不上1G内存的苹果5S,而且会越来越卡!为什么会这样呢?曾经小米的高管曾说过 , 少装app,小米的手机也可以很流畅,但是不装app,手机的作用就削弱了好多,这样的手机就没有多大吸引力了吧!为什么配置越高的安卓手机比低配置的苹果手机要卡顿呢?为什么装了同样的app的苹果IOS比安卓流畅那么多呢?
前两年发布的IOS8让大家第一次认识到苹果原来也会卡,但是这个卡比安卓却迟来了好多年!安卓跟苹果最大的区别就是 安卓是一个开放的系统 各种源代码都可以自己开发 而苹果则封闭得多 这样我们平时使用的时候 我们可以从各种渠道获取安卓程序 但这些程序各个渠道又不一样 安全性和稳定性也不能保证 用着用着就卡了 苹果下载软件只能从app store 安全得多 稳定性也强 所以苹果系统最大的优点在于流畅
造成安卓手机卡顿的原因可分为三点:
一、这是由系统机制决定的,安卓程序都是运行在JAVA虚拟机上的,虚拟机的作用也就是上面故事里的翻译官,而不像iPhone手机那样直接运行在操作系统上 。该虚拟机就像是个垃圾生成器和内存大老虎 , 非常消耗内存,会产生很多垃圾 , 安卓机会随着程序安装的程序越多 , cpu能耗越大,从而越来越卡,而且随着用的时间越久,会越来越卡;最终都会走上不停刷机的不归路,刷机又可能出错,所以让人很蛋疼 。
二、安卓内存多任务机制,从理论上来说JAVA可自动杀死后台APP回收内存,但是JAVA虚拟机却不能做到随用随收,当我们在使用安卓手机玩天天跑酷或雷霆战机等游戏时 , 每隔一小会难免会出现一两秒钟的卡顿,这就是JAVA虚拟机在强制回收其他APP占用的内存,而如果手机的硬件不够强大 , 安卓手机则根本无力回收这些被占用的内存,最终造成手机一直卡顿直到死机重启 。
三、安卓APP渣优化 , 由于安卓系统的开源,大多数软件开发商都不严格按照安卓系统软件的设计规定去执行,APP越做越臃肿,再高的硬件也被渣优化的安卓APP吃掉了 。
如何避免让安卓手机越用越卡?参考下面六点
1、追求流畅的安卓手机用户可选择ROOT,精简化手机里内置软件 , 把不用的卸载掉 。
2、每天给自己的安卓手机关机一次,每月给自己的安卓手机恢复一次出厂设置 。
3、软件厂商在推出新软件时,安卓手机用户不必急于更新,可耐心等上几个礼拜 。
4、多清除缓存等垃圾,这些东西非常占手机内存 。
5、安装软件尽量别安到机身内存,安装到SD卡里面最好 。
6、刷机,有风险需谨慎,没有经验的朋友可在网上多查一些此方面的内容后在进行操作 。
JAVA编程小游戏(雷霆战机) , 程序运行无错误 , 但是不能启动键盘监听?不要用键盘监听,键盘事件只会传递给当前获得焦点的组件 。
使用按键映射,绑定InputMap和ActionMap,具体做法可以自己搜相关内容 。
破解游戏合集能不能搜索开放注册以前 , 本人以游客身份学习了各位大大的教程已成功破解了30多款游戏!现在把我的学到的告诉大家!
---------------------------------手机端破解:破解工具:Dalvik字节码编辑器(百度下载)---------------------------------破解方法:
1:此方法比较简单 但是仅适用于少数游戏(雷霆战机2) 打开Dalvik字节码编辑器(以下简称 工具) 找到所要破解的游戏 点击进入 会有几个文件和文件夹,接着打开文件 classes.dex
一样有许多文件和文件夹 点击手机的菜单键(不要跟我说菜单键找不到!手机屏幕下方的那三个触摸键!) 选择搜索字符串 搜索 gc_billing_fail 一样会有3个文件 选择 cn\emagsoftwarel\gamebilling\view\$1 然后也有三种选择 选择methods onbillingsuccess内容全部复制把onuselopercallcer内容删除 , 再粘贴再把onbillingfair的内容删除,再粘贴,然后一直保存,回退到刚打开安装包的那个页面打开Androidmanifest.html 以后删除此代码: android permisson sends sms(删除这个是踢除游戏发送短信的权限) 最后保存 。保存成功后,会在原来的游戏安装包下面出来自己破解的安装包!安装即可!(如果未破解的版本安装了的话 , 先卸载!再安装破解版!不然两个软件签名不同,不能安装)------------------------------!搜索的gc_billing_fail称之为游戏的string,每个游戏都有string,而找到string需要将apk反编译(手机端反编译利器apktool)----------------------------------
2:用到的工具还是一样,此方法大多数游戏都能破解,唯一的缺点就是麻烦,费时!还要得懂点代码的意思
游戏中,付费成功会有:购买成功、支付成功、已购买等等的提示语!付费失败则反之!---------------------------------首先第一步:安装游戏,进游戏查看其提示语是什么!我自己破解的游戏过程(狂斩三国—单击版) “支付失败”呵呵!那就简单了! 用工具打开安装包打开classes.dex菜单键 选择搜索字符串 搜索:支付失败 有三个文件 起初我是把三个文件里的都修改了!才知道这样会乱码 程序不能运行,三个支付失败的方法中只有一个是真正实现跳转的,那么,我能不能给三个文件中的支付失败的提示语后面标上1,2,3,呢?再保存安装包 , 安装运行游戏,看看到底那个才是实现跳转的,于是乎,付费失败提示“支付失败3”嘿嘿!这就简单了!用工具打开刚修改过得安装包搜索:支付失败3 就会出来文件 选择打开 下面我把代码粘贴过来讲解!带()的是我的注解
const/16 v0 0x9if-ne v6 v0 :label_21(这个代码的意思是:如果什么什么的值不为0就跳转到label_21 这个就是跳转命令,我们要看看它跳转项的内容是什么)invoke-static {} Lcn/koogame/market/MarketLogic;-getInstance()Lcn/koogame/market/MarketLogic;move-result-object v0invoke-static {} Lcn/koogame/market/MarketLogic;-getInstance()Lcn/koogame/market/MarketLogic;move-result-object v1iget-object v1 v1 Lcn/koogame/market/MarketLogic;-alixBPID:Ljava/lang/String;const/4 v2 1const-string v3 "支付成功"invoke-virtual {v0,v1,v2,v3} Lcn/koogame/market/MarketLogic;-payCallback(Ljava/lang/String;ILjava/lang/String;)Vlabel_20:return-voidlabel_21:(跳转项-----------------以下便是label_21的内容)invoke-static {} Lcn/koogame/market/MarketLogic;-getInstance()Lcn/koogame/market/MarketLogic;move-result-object v0invoke-static {} Lcn/koogame/market/MarketLogic;-getInstance()Lcn/koogame/market/MarketLogic;move-result-object v1iget-object v1 v1 Lcn/koogame/market/MarketLogic;-alixBPID:Ljava/lang/String;const/4 v2 0const-string v3 "支付失败3"(支付失败!嘿嘿!直接把支付失败的跳转项删除,再把开头的跳转命令删除 然后保存)invoke-virtual {v0,v1,v2,v3} Lcn/koogame/market/MarketLogic;-payCallback(Ljava/lang/String;ILjava/lang/String;)Vgoto :label_20----------------------------------下面把我修改过后的代码粘贴过来 , 大家可以对照下----------------------------------
const/16 v0 0x9
invoke-static {} Lcn/koogame/market/MarketLogic;-getInstance()Lcn/koogame/market/MarketLogic;move-result-object v0invoke-static {} Lcn/koogame/market/MarketLogic;-getInstance()Lcn/koogame/market/MarketLogic;move-result-object v1iget-object v1 v1 Lcn/koogame/market/MarketLogic;-alixBPID:Ljava/lang/String;const/4 v2 1const-string v3 "支付成功"invoke-virtual {v0,v1,v2,v3} Lcn/koogame/market/MarketLogic;-payCallback(Ljava/lang/String;ILjava/lang/String;)Vlabel_20:return-void
invoke-virtual {v0,v1,v2,v3} Lcn/koogame/market/MarketLogic;-payCallback(Ljava/lang/String;ILjava/lang/String;)Vgoto :label_20
【炫酷java雷霆战机代码 炫酷java雷霆战机代码是什么】关于炫酷java雷霆战机代码和炫酷java雷霆战机代码是什么的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站 。

    推荐阅读